Compare all specifications:
2007 Audi A6 | 2004 Volkswagen Bora | |
Make | Audi | Volkswagen |
Model | A6 | Bora |
Year Released | 2007 | 2004 |
Body Type | Station Wagon |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2698 cc | 1595 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 179 HP | 104 HP |
Engine RPM | 3300 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 380 Nm | 148 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1400 RPM | 4500 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 17.0:1 | 10.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 223 km/hour | 180 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 9.1 seconds | 12.8 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1695 kg | 1211 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4590 mm | 4380 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1860 mm | 1740 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1470 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2850 mm | 2520 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 8.3 L/100km | 8.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 80 L | 55 L |
